Former Florida lawmaker pleads guilty to Covid relief fraud charges.

TL;DR Summary
Former Florida Republican state Rep. Joseph Harding pleaded guilty to wire fraud, money laundering, and making false statements in connection with Covid-19 relief fraud. Harding acquired over $150,000 in Small Business Administration loans by lying on loan applications. He is scheduled to be sentenced on July 25 and could face up to 20 years in prison for wire fraud, 10 years for money laundering, and five years for making false statements.
